CSGO News: VP, FaZe, Falcons punch playoff tickets at PGL Bucharest

Add to Favorite
Added to Favorite


Virtus.pro, FaZe Clan and Team Falcons won Thursday’s Round 5 matches to reach the playoffs at the $625,000 PGL Bucharest 2025 event in Romania.

Virtus.pro recorded a 2-0 victory over Astralis and FaZe Clan advanced by the same score against Apogee Esports.

Virtus.pro posted a 13-10 win on Dust II and a 13-6 victory on Train, while FaZe Clan secured a 13-5 triumph on Dust II and a 13-8 win on Ancient.

Team Falcons rallied for a 2-1 defeat of The MongolZ, overcoming a 13-9 setback on Mirage to post a 13-6 victory on Dust II and a 16-14 triumph on Ancient.

G2 Esports, 3DMAX, GamerLegion, Complexity and Aurora Gaming previously qualified for the single-elimination playoffs.

All remaining Counter-Strike 2 matches are best-of-three until Sunday’s best-of-five grand final, with the winner taking home $200,000.

The playoffs begin Friday with the quarterfinals:
–G2 Esports vs. Virtus.pro
–Aurora Gaming vs. Complexity
–FaZe Clan vs. 3DMAX
–GamerLegion vs. Team Falcons

PGL Bucharest 2025 prize pool:
1. $200,000
2. $93,750
3. $75,000
4. $43,750
5-8. $31,250
9-11. $15,625 — Astralis, Apogee Esports, The MongolZ
12-14. $9,375 — Rare Atom, FURIA, Legacy
15-16. $6,250 — Team Liquid, paiN Gaming
